Normal Operation
The lighting control module (LCM) sends a voltage reference signal to the headlamp switch through circuit 477 (LB/BK). When the fog lamp switch is engaged, the signal is routed to ground. When a request for the fog lamps is detected, the LCM provides voltage to the fog lamp relay coil through circuit 1347 (DB/WH). Ground for the fog lamp relay coil is provided through circuit 57 (BK). Voltage for the fog lamps is provided by the battery junction box (BJB) through circuit 1669 (OG/LG). When the fog lamp relay is energized, voltage is routed to the fog lamps through circuit 478 (TN/OG).
Possible Causes
- Fuse
- Circuit 57 (BK) open
- Circuit 477 (LB/BK) open
- Circuit 478 (TN/OG) open
- Circuit 1347 (DB/WH) open or short to ground
- Circuit 1669 (OG/LG) open
- Fog lamp relay
- Headlamp switch
- LCM
